The Mathematical Foundation Supporting Our Game

The game follows its beginnings to a captivating demonstration on The Price Is Right television show in ’83, where it became designed to demonstrate principles of statistical theory. The scientist Frank Riolo developed the original design based on its Galton Board, a apparatus invented by Dr. Francis Galton in early 1890s to demonstrate the central theorem theorem and Gaussian distribution. This established historical fact positions our game as something beyond than mere amusement—it represents a practical application of mathematical science that users can experience directly.

Its beauty of Plinko demo lies in its beautiful simplicity merged with mathematical depth. When you launch a disc from the top of our pegged board, it meets multiple decision moments where physics dictates the trajectory. Individual peg collision generates a binary choice, and the combined effect of multiple interactions produces a probability distribution of outcomes across the base prize slots.

Knowing Your Winning Probabilities

The mathematical structure of our game creates a defined distribution pattern although each individual launch being random. Central slots receive a highest frequency of results due to binomial binomial probability pattern, while edge locations capture fewer discs but typically offer higher multipliers as compensation. The platform edge varies depending on risk modes and multiplier setups, generally ranging between 1% and 3% for reputable implementations.

  1. Middle Slot Probability: Around 3-5% chance per specific slot in the middle positions, providing moderate multipliers near 1-5x range
  2. Near-Edge Positions: Approximately 1-2% probability per slot, offering enhanced multipliers typically between 10-50x your stake
  3. Maximum Edge Slots: Below than 0.5% occurrence chance, containing the highest multipliers that can reach 100x to 1000× in high-risk configurations

Return to Player Specifications

Our theoretical return to player percentage for the game remains competitive within the internet casino industry. Typical versions maintain payout values between 97% and 99%, indicating the mathematical calculation returns that amount of total wagers to players over long-term sessions. Individual performances naturally deviate from expected values due to volatility, but the core mathematics ensures long-term fairness that benefits sustained play across this platform.
